/**
 * INBOX0 generic command definition
 */
union dmub_inbox0_cmd_common {
	struct {
		uint32_t command_code: 8; /**< INBOX0 command code */
		uint32_t param: 24; /**< 24-bit parameter */
	} bits;
	uint32_t all;
};

/**
 * INBOX0 hw_lock command definition
 */
union dmub_inbox0_cmd_lock_hw {
	struct {
		uint32_t command_code: 8;

		/* NOTE: Must be have enough bits to match: enum hw_lock_client */
		uint32_t hw_lock_client: 1;

		/* NOTE: Below fields must match with: struct dmub_hw_lock_inst_flags */
		uint32_t otg_inst: 3;
		uint32_t opp_inst: 3;
		uint32_t dig_inst: 3;

		/* NOTE: Below fields must match with: union dmub_hw_lock_flags */
		uint32_t lock_pipe: 1;
		uint32_t lock_cursor: 1;
		uint32_t lock_dig: 1;
		uint32_t triple_buffer_lock: 1;

		uint32_t lock: 1;				/**< Lock */
		uint32_t should_release: 1;		/**< Release */
		uint32_t reserved: 8; 			/**< Reserved for extending more clients, HW, etc. */
	} bits;
	uint32_t all;
};

union dmub_inbox0_data_register {
	union dmub_inbox0_cmd_common inbox0_cmd_common;
	union dmub_inbox0_cmd_lock_hw inbox0_cmd_lock_hw;
};

enum dmub_inbox0_command {
	/**
	 * DESC: Invalid command, ignored.
	 */
	DMUB_INBOX0_CMD__INVALID_COMMAND = 0,
	/**
	 * DESC: Notification to acquire/release HW lock
	 * ARGS:
	 */
	DMUB_INBOX0_CMD__HW_LOCK = 1,
};

/**
 * @brief Determines the next ringbuffer offset.
 *
 * @param rb DMUB inbox ringbuffer
 * @param num_cmds Number of commands
 * @param next_rptr The next offset in the ringbuffer
 */
static inline void dmub_rb_get_rptr_with_offset(struct dmub_rb *rb,
				  uint32_t num_cmds,
				  uint32_t *next_rptr)
{
	*next_rptr = rb->rptr + DMUB_RB_CMD_SIZE * num_cmds;

	if (*next_rptr >= rb->capacity)
		*next_rptr %= rb->capacity;
}

/**
 * @brief Returns a pointer to a command in the inbox.
 *
 * @param rb DMUB inbox ringbuffer
 * @param cmd The inbox command to return
 * @param rptr The ringbuffer offset
 * @return true if not empty
 * @return false otherwise
 */
static inline bool dmub_rb_peek_offset(struct dmub_rb *rb,
				 union dmub_rb_cmd  **cmd,
				 uint32_t rptr)
{
	uint8_t *rb_cmd = (uint8_t *)(rb->base_address) + rptr;

	if (dmub_rb_empty(rb))
		return false;

	*cmd = (union dmub_rb_cmd *)rb_cmd;

	return true;
}
